    Right now my server is running ISPConfig version 2.1.2, and i have to upgrade it to the newest version, BUT before I do that the two following things pop up.

    1) I want to make a total backup of the server (wise decission!) but I cant seem to find rdiff-backup for my Suse 9.2 version, does anybody know of a other way to make a backup???

    2) Do I have to upgrade from 2.1.2 to the next version, or can I go from 2.1.2 directly to the newest version?

    Have you tried to install it from tar.gz?

    http://www.nongnu.org/rdiff-backup/

    You can install the latest version directly.
